🔧 Architecture

Session Management (CRITICAL FIX)

Before (Flask):

  • In-memory dict: sessions = {}
  • Lost on restart

After (FastAPI):

  • Redis with TTL
  • Persistent across restarts
  • User sessions: 7 days
  • File sessions: 1 hour
  • Auto-cleanup

Authentication Flow

  1. Login → JWT access token (30 min) + refresh token (7 days)
  2. Refresh token stored in Redis
  3. Frontend sends: Authorization: Bearer <access_token>
  4. Token expired? → Use refresh token to get new access token
  5. Logout → Delete session from Redis

File Processing Flow

  1. Upload files → Save to uploads/{user_id}/{YYYYMMDD}/
  2. Create session in Redis with file info
  3. Generate metadata (AI/Excel/Import/Manual/Template)
  4. User reviews/edits metadata
  5. Update file with metadata
  6. Download processed file
  7. Cleanup (automatic after 7 days)

🗄️ Database

SQLite (Default)

Location: backend/data/oliver_metadata.db

Pros:

  • Simple, no setup
  • Good for single server
  • Easy migration from Flask

Cons:

  • No concurrent writes
  • Not for multi-server deployment

PostgreSQL (Optional)

Pros:

  • Better performance
  • Concurrent connections
  • Multi-server support

To enable:

# docker-compose.fastapi.yml
environment:
  DATABASE_URL: postgresql+asyncpg://oliver:${DB_PASSWORD}@postgres:5432/oliver_metadata

🔒 Security

Production Checklist

  • Change SECRET_KEY to random 64-char string
  • Enable HTTPS (set REDIRECT_URI to https://)
  • Restrict CORS origins in main.py
  • Set DEBUG=false in production
  • Use PostgreSQL instead of SQLite for multi-server
  • Enable Redis password: redis://user:password@host:6379/0
  • Regular backups of database and uploads
  • Monitor Redis memory usage
